Empowering Concept, Practical—but a Bit Repetitive
The Let Them Theory offers a simple but powerful mindset shift: stop expending energy trying to control or manage other people’s opinions and behaviors, and instead focus on what you can control—your reactions, goals, and priorities.
I appreciated the core message—“Let Them” paired with “Let Me”—which helps you let go of stress about others while reclaiming your own energy. It’s a refreshing reminder if you tend to people-please or give too much weight to what others think. The book is filled with clear examples, real-life stories, and practical reflection points, which make the theory easier to internalize.
That said, the content can feel repetitive at times—many chapters circle back to the same point, so you might feel like you’ve read the key idea after the first few sections. A few readers online even joked you could fit the concept on a sticky note! But if repetition helps reinforce mindset changes for you, this style might actually be a strength.
Overall, this book is a solid choice if you’re new to personal-development books or want a motivational boost to focus more on your life and less on others’ expectations. If you’re very familiar with self-help concepts already, you might find the insights familiar—but many readers still find value in the gentle reminders and practical applications
